Hint: hammock camping in Red River Gorge would be very easy). Building fires: You can have a campfire in the Gorge as long as it’s 100 feet away from a cliff or rock shelter. Just do it carefully. Closed to all motorized vehicles and mountain bikes. Natural Bridge State Resort Park, adjacent to Red River Gorge Geological Area, is administered by Kentucky Dept. of Parks. It offers lodge rooms, cabins, dining facilities, and two developed campgrounds. For more information, call the park at (606) 663-2214, or (800) The USDA Forest Office is located in Winchester, Kentucky about an hour from Red River Gorge. For up to date information either stop in the Ranger District Office, visit their website or telephone: (859) 745-3100. As the COVID-19 pandemic evolves, countries have taken steps to mitigate how risky it is t...Koomer Ridge Campground features semi-primitive camping in a tranquil forest setting. The campground provides access to trails in the Red River Gorge . This campground is located in the Red River Gorge on Cumberland District of the Daniel Boone National Forest. Natural Bridge State Resort Park in Kentucky, more commonly known as “Natural Bridge State Park,” is one of Kentucky’s original four state parks. The 2,300-acre nature preserve offers a more curated, accessible experience than the nearby Red River Gorge and the wilder Clifty Wilderness area in Daniel Boone National Forest.Nada Tunnel is a historic 900-foot (270 m) long tunnel along Kentucky Route 77 in Powell County, Kentucky, in the United States. Formerly a railway tunnel, the tunnel has often been described as the "Gateway to Red River Gorge" for the shortcut it provides motorists to the Red River Gorge canyons of the Daniel Boone National …

Make sure to leave no trace as well.This trail is located in the Red River Gorge on Cumberland District of the Daniel Boone National Forest. The Red River Gorge Geological Area has more than 100 natural arches, the greatest concentration of arches east of the Rocky Mountains.
